The Directors



The Foundation presently has three directors that serve to determine the distribution of all funds for grant applications. These directors serve voluntarily and bring various backgrounds to the Foundation, but basic to all is the genuine desire to make a difference in seeing more children in safe and flourishing environments. the Directors share goals of funding programs that meet the immediate and critical need for children, including effective long term creative solutions to the underlying problems.
